Africa is the hometown of the two major varieties of coffee, Arabica and Robusta, while Uganda, which is located in eastern Africa and enjoys the laudatory names of "plateau water hometown" and "Pearl of East Africa", is believed by many people to be the birthplace of Robusta.
The cultivation of coffee in Uganda is all small-scale family operation. The livelihood of 25% of the population is closely related to coffee production. About 500000 farms grow coffee, but mainly Robster. Robusta accounts for 90% of coffee production, and the remaining 1 is Arabica coffee. The collection time for Arabica and Robusta is from October to February.

The name of "Typica" iron pickup truck sounds majestic and powerful, but in fact it is not so strong. It has a weak physique, poor disease resistance, easy to catch rust leaf disease, and produces less fruit. It is one of the oldest native varieties in Ethiopia, and many Arabica are derived from iron pickups!
